WebInstruct teens to use oven mitts or potholders to remove items from the oven or stove and teach them how to use a microwave safely. Make a habit of placing matches, gasoline and lighters in a safe place, out of children’s reach. Avoid novelty lighters or lighters that look like toys. Fire and burns go together.
